From 8f65427391c8a28418e3cae013f33aa04126aa65 Mon Sep 17 00:00:00 2001 From: Marc Rousavy Date: Wed, 29 Sep 2021 10:38:49 +0200 Subject: [PATCH] fix: Fix ExtensionsManager abstract method crash by adding ProGuard rule (#466) --- android/build.gradle | 1 + android/proguard-rules.pro | 2 ++ 2 files changed, 3 insertions(+) create mode 100644 android/proguard-rules.pro diff --git a/android/build.gradle b/android/build.gradle index c8a58ce..be2a00a 100644 --- a/android/build.gradle +++ b/android/build.gradle @@ -88,6 +88,7 @@ android { defaultConfig { minSdkVersion 21 targetSdkVersion getExtOrIntegerDefault('targetSdkVersion') + consumerProguardFiles 'proguard-rules.pro' externalNativeBuild { cmake { diff --git a/android/proguard-rules.pro b/android/proguard-rules.pro new file mode 100644 index 0000000..c8c9ed4 --- /dev/null +++ b/android/proguard-rules.pro @@ -0,0 +1,2 @@ +# VisionCamera (CameraX) +-keep class androidx.camera.extensions.** { *; }